Broward to join worldwide climate strike
Students to strike school at the Broward County Public School Building

Dozens of Broward residents will join the worldwide #ClimateStrike called by Greta Thunberg. Youth have been striking from school to demand action on climate change – now, for the first time, they are calling on adults to walk out of their jobs and homes to join the Climate Strike. 
Broward’s event is one of the hundreds of Climate Strike events on September 20th, taking place in over 90 countries worldwide. 

WHAT: Students will protest in front of the Public School district building, right around the corner from the federal courthouse. There will be many speakers that will address the different impacts of climate change on local communities and many notable attendees.At noon, there will be 11 minutes of silence for the 11 years that the IPCC reports we have left until we reach 2 degrees Celcius, a point of no return. Afterward, students and organizers will be available to answer questions about why they are striking.

WHEN: September 20th, 11:30 AM to 1:30 PM 

WHERE: Broward County Public Schools Building, 600 SE 3rd Ave, Fort Lauderdale, FL 33301
